Cheese- most places or recipes will do a half block of cheese and half block of sausage on a skewer. If it’s too thick, it will be difficult to wrap around the skewer and you will end up with way too much breading. If the batter is too runny, it will be very frustrating trying to assemble the corn dogs. I tested and tested the batter recipe until I got the perfect measurements for a batter that is easily manageable, and fries to crispy golden perfection. Tips for making the best Korean corn dogs Batter– make sure you measure the batter ingredients out exactly. Condiments- the usual ketchup and mustard, but add a sprinkle of sugar all over for a sweet and savory treat! I know it sounds a little weird but it’s actually pretty common for Korean snack foods to have this type of combo.Potato- this is optional! The little potato bites in the batter will fry up like little french fries- it’s a little more work to pack this into the batter but it’s soooo innovative and good! You can also use packaged frozen french fries instead.

*NOTE: most sausage links/hotdogs are already cooked. I like Cajun style andouille sausages because they have better flavor and they are thick. Sausage– you can use whatever sausage links you like.Panko– the panko breadcrumbs will help hold everything together and give it a nice color & crisp.Batter- water, all purpose flour, sugar, active dry yeast, and salt.Another thing that differentiates Korean from American corn dogs is the added sugar, or use of rice cakes or fishcakes instead of a hot dog. I could be wrong, but I think that is a Korean innovation of the corn dog. I’m not 100% sure, but I don’t think I have ever seen an American corn dog like that. Korean corn dogs are also known to sometimes have potato added to the batter to make french fries. American corn dogs usually have a soft, doughnut-like batter. The result is a crispier batter, which I think is much better. American corn dogs are usually made with corn meal and use eggs as a binder, while Korean corn dogs are made with a yeasted batter and coated in panko bread crumbs.
